Transaction 9496f89f9931fcfe28b8aae3b30499f8bd40ac621c61e7eb2834049e73fbbb3a
1 Input
1 Output
-
9496f89f9931fcfe28b8aae3b30499f8bd40ac621c61e7eb2834049e73fbbb3a:0
- value
- 5103165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cb81e05604c6e1aa3857998b73eb47cf26979ea OP_EQUAL
- address
- 3BbsTxG9w5iCz1T2tahBzdQA618guoxMAJ